IMPACT Foundation
The IMPACT Foundation of the Philippines is affiliated with three medical facilities in the Philippines. These are the Ilocos Training & Regional Medical center in Ilocos, the Jose R. Reyes Memorial Medical center in Manila and the Maria Reyna Hospital of Northern Mindanao. These three facilities, with their 48 years of combined cleft care experience, are continually working to provide free surgery to poor children with clefts and to improve their quality of care. With the assistance of a Smile Train grant, IMPACT will be able to provide treatment to an additional 200 patients in 2007.

Mijares-Gurango Craniofacial Foundation
Since 2002, the Smile Train has provided grants to the Mijares-Gurango Craniofacial Foundation. Located at the Philippine General Hospital, Mijares-Gurango is a cleft-care foundation started by Dr. Pilita Mijares Gurango and her husband who wanted to fulfill their desire to provide surgical care to their country’s poorest patients. Since receiving its first Smile Train grant, the Foundation has been able to provide free cleft care to over 175 patients. With the renewed assistance of The Smile Train, the foundation will able to provide long-term cleft care for an additional 100 indigent patients.

Noordhoff Craniofacial Foundation/Chang Gung Memorial Hospital
The Smile Train's first project in the Philippines was established with the Noordhoff Craniofacial Foundation (NCF) and the Chang Gung Memorial Hospital (Taiwan). The goal is to develop a cleft center on the island of Mindanao in the Philippines. The NCF has identified a qualified hospital in General Santos, Mindanao, and local surgeon Ramon E. Gonzales, M.D., an anesthesiologist, and a social worker/speech pathologist for further training. Under the medical directorship of M. Samuel Noordhoff, M.D., The Smile Train's support has enabled 250 surgeries to be performed by the cleft team in Mindanao and is currently providing for an additional 200 cleft surgeries.

Our Lady of Peace Hospital
The Our Lady of Peace Hospital was established in 2002 to provide the poor with access to affordable quality medical care. With the help of the Noordhoff Craniofacial Foundation, Foundation of Our Lady of Peace Missions, Inc., and a band of volunteer doctors, the Our Lady of Peace Craniofacial Center (OLPCC) was created in February of 2003. A Treatment Grant from The Smile Train will enable OLPCC to purchase new surgical equipment for cleft treatment that will help hundreds of children receive quality cleft surgery and provide 30 underserved children with the cleft surgery they need. Dr. Glenda H. de Villa will be overseeing this project.

Philippine Band of Mercy
The Smile Train-Philippine Band of Mercy Cleft Program which began in 2002 provides surgical treatment to indigent children born in the Philippines with clefts. Cleft lip and palate teams at Pasig City General Hospital, St. Jude General Hospital and Medical Center, Dr. Nicanor Reyes Medical Hospital, and St. Martin de Porres Hospitals have been able to perform over 860 cleft lip and palate surgeries with funding from The Smile Train. Jesus Perez Cardenas, director of this program, and Drs. Raymund Erese, Stanley Kho, Melanio Cruz, Nicanor Reyes, and Hector Santos supervise the program. This year alone, Philippine Band of Mercy will treat an additional 250 children with The Smile Train's support.
